linux文件复制粘贴删除命令行
-
在Linux系统中,我们可以使用命令行来进行文件的复制、粘贴和删除操作。下面将介绍一些常用的命令。
1. 复制文件:cp命令
要复制一个文件或目录,可以使用cp命令。其基本语法如下:
cp [选项] 源文件 目标文件例如,要将文件file1复制到目录dir中,可以使用以下命令:
cp file1 dir/如果要复制整个目录及其内容,可以使用-r或者-R选项:
cp -r dir1 dir2/2. 粘贴文件:mv命令
要将文件或目录粘贴到指定位置,可以使用mv命令。其基本语法如下:
mv [选项] 源文件 目标文件例如,要将文件file1粘贴到目录dir中,可以使用以下命令:
mv file1 dir/如果目标文件已经存在,mv命令会用新的文件覆盖原有文件。
3. 删除文件:rm命令
要删除文件或目录,可以使用rm命令。其基本语法如下:
rm [选项] 文件例如,要删除文件file1,可以使用以下命令:
rm file1如果要删除目录及其内容,可以使用-r或者-R选项:
rm -r dir/注意:删除的文件或目录将不会被放入回收站,而是直接被永久删除,请谨慎操作。
除了以上三个基本命令外,还有一些其他的相关命令,如查看目录内容的ls命令、移动文件或重命名的mv命令等。在使用命令行操作文件时,可以通过man命令来查阅具体的命令使用说明和参数选项。命令行具有强大的功能和灵活性,熟练掌握这些命令可以提高工作效率。
2年前 -
Linux是一个基于UNIX的操作系统,提供了丰富的命令行工具来进行文件操作。下面是一些常用的Linux文件复制、粘贴和删除命令行操作:
1. 复制文件:可以使用`cp`命令来复制文件。下面是一个典型的使用示例:
“`
cp source_file destination_file
“`
这将把source_file复制到destination_file。例如,要将一个名为file1.txt的文件复制到一个名为file2.txt的文件,可以运行以下命令:
“`
cp file1.txt file2.txt
“`2. 复制目录:要复制整个目录及其所有内容,可以使用`cp`命令的`-r`选项。下面是一个示例:
“`
cp -r source_directory destination_directory
“`
这将把source_directory目录及其内容复制到destination_directory。例如,要将一个名为dir1的目录复制到一个名为dir2的目录,可以运行以下命令:
“`
cp -r dir1 dir2
“`3. 粘贴文件:在Linux中,没有一个特定的命令用于粘贴文件。相反,您只需使用`cp`命令将文件从一个位置复制到另一个位置即可。
4. 删除文件:要删除文件,可以使用`rm`命令。下面是一个使用示例:
“`
rm file_name
“`
这将删除名为file_name的文件。例如,要删除一个名为file1.txt的文件,可以运行以下命令:
“`
rm file1.txt
“`5. 删除目录:要删除一个空目录,可以使用`rmdir`命令。例如,要删除一个名为dir1的空目录,可以运行以下命令:
“`
rmdir dir1
“`如果要删除一个非空目录及其所有内容,可以使用`rm`命令的`-r`选项。例如,要删除一个名为dir2的目录及其所有内容,可以运行以下命令:
“`
rm -r dir2
“`请注意,这些命令都是非常强大的,对文件和目录的操作具有潜在的风险。所以在使用这些命令之前,请确保您知道自己在做什么,并且仔细阅读相关的文档或参考资料。
2年前 -
Linux系统中,文件管理的命令行操作是非常常见和重要的任务之一。本文将介绍Linux系统中文件的复制、粘贴和删除操作的命令行工具和方法。
一、文件复制
文件复制是将指定的文件复制到一个新的位置或者重命名的操作。1. cp命令
cp命令是Linux系统中最常用的文件复制命令,它的语法格式如下:
“`
cp [选项] 源文件 目标文件
“`– 选项说明:
– -i 交互模式,若目标文件已经存在则会询问是否覆盖
– -r 递归复制目录及其子目录下的所有文件
– -p 保留文件的属性,如文件的权限、所有者、时间戳等
– -f 强制复制,即不询问是否覆盖目标文件– 示例:
将文件file1复制到当前目录下,并将新的文件命名为file2:
“`
cp file1 file2
“`
将目录dir1及其子目录下的所有文件复制到目录dir2下:
“`
cp -r dir1 dir2
“`二、文件粘贴
文件粘贴是将之前复制的文件粘贴到指定的位置。1. mv命令
mv命令不仅可以用来移动文件和目录,还可以用来重命名文件和目录。它的语法格式如下:
“`
mv [选项] 源文件 目标文件
“`– 选项说明:
– -i 交互模式,若目标文件已经存在则会询问是否覆盖
– -f 强制覆盖目标文件,不询问
– -u 只在源文件的内容或者修改时间较新时才执行移动操作– 示例:
将文件file2移动到目录dir1下:
“`
mv file2 dir1/
“`
将文件file1重命名为file3:
“`
mv file1 file3
“`三、文件删除
文件删除是将指定的文件从文件系统中永久删除的操作。1. rm命令
rm命令是Linux系统中最常用的文件删除命令,它的语法格式如下:
“`
rm [选项] 文件
“`– 选项说明:
– -i 交互模式,删除文件时询问是否确认
– -r 递归删除目录及其子目录下的所有文件
– -f 强制删除,不询问确认– 示例:
删除文件file1:
“`
rm file1
“`
删除目录dir1及其子目录下的所有文件:
“`
rm -r dir1
“`四、总结
本文介绍了Linux系统中文件复制、粘贴和删除的命令行操作。通过cp命令可以实现文件的复制操作,通过mv命令可以实现文件的移动和重命名操作,通过rm命令可以实现文件的删除操作。这些命令都是非常有用的工具,熟练掌握它们可以提高文件管理的效率。2年前